Mixed from Moscow by @katyayonder A new mix for us was recorded by Katya Yonder — an artist, producer, and sound designer. Since childhood, Katya has been deeply in love with music. She first explored her parents’ vinyl collection, which ranged from medieval compositions and the Viennese and Russian classical schools to electronic music and ’70s–’80s pop. With the arrival of the internet, she immersed herself even further, exploring both fashionable and unfashionable, strange and familiar corners of the musical landscape. In early February, Katya released her new album Distant Closeness, dedicated to long-distance relationships. In it, she blends the retro sound of her favorite ’70s–’80s film scores with contemporary synthesis, all infused with a fairy-tale atmosphere. The album was released on @keelo_music — a multi-genre label community she recently launched together with two other musicians and artists. “I often find myself in a situation where I want to play a great track while I’m with friends, but we only have access to streaming platforms, and for some reason, it’s not there. So in this mix, I’ve gathered my discoveries from different years. Most of these tracks have been with me for a long time, even though the quality of the digitized versions often left much to be desired. A new mix in our calmness series was recorded by @rab.neba — a music producer and designer who has been working in ambient, electronic, and hip-hop genres since 2012. In 2023, his debut album (A)Iphoria was released on the Imum Coeli label. His style blends elements of electronic music, ambient, vaporwave, and dungeon synth. A new mix has been recorded for us by @fmsao9000 , aka Evgeny Shchukin — a southern cultural figure, music producer, and co-founder of the independent label @fuselabrecords . We’ve encountered his musical work twice already in our numbered series. The first time was through the project WOLS, where Zhenya explores the edges of hyperpop — a project that recently evolved into a full band performing instrumental live shows. The world of FMSAO, on the other hand, blends the beauty of nature with artifacts of a not-so-distant future. It’s here that his more abstract ambient forms emerge — built on dotted minor-key sequences, enveloping pads, and deeply pulsating rhythms. Mixed from Moscow by @jrssophia Musician and selector Sofia Zhuravkova has recorded a new mixtape for our series. Her music is a delicate and contemplative soundscape crafted from field recordings, electronic and electroacoustic sounds, drones, and spoken word. Her music can be found in the catalogs of Infinito Audio, Ny Agenda, and Best Effort. Today, Sonia is a regular resident of NTS radio and one-half of the duo @ewer___ Her monthly show focuses on contemporary interpretations of the ambient genre. Mixed from Moscow by @settimatacca We are excited to introduce you to a new story brought to life by Moscow-based multidisciplinary artist Apollinaria Kaspars, also known as Settima Tacca. Despite her cinematic album Wondrous Feelings of Ages Long Gone released on vinyl last year, her latest self-published release, Demos 4 Nobody, has a much more outsider feel. It leans heavily on raw rhythms, minimalist synths, and guitar experiments.
